﻿

        .NAVValidationError {font-size: 0.75em; color: Red; }
		.NAVPanel{}

        .NAVChart{}
            
		.dateContainer{ margin-top:10px;}
		.dateLabel {float: left; padding-top: 8px;}            
        .beginDate { margin-left:5px;}
        .endDate { margin-left:20px;}
        
		/* Changed for IE8 compatability */
		.showHistory {/* position:relative; top:-20px;	*/ clear:left; margin: 10 0 0 35px;	}            
		.selectedLink { font-weight:bold; text-decoration:none;}   
        .panelView { margin-bottom:10px;}
        .ddlView { margin-left:5px; width:150px;}
        
        .headerDate { float:left; background-color: #556292; color: White; text-align: center; border-top: solid 1px #004528; border-right: solid 1px #ece9d8; border-bottom: solid 1px #004528; border-left: solid 1px #004528; padding: 3px; margin:0 0 1px 0; width:214px; } /* position:relative; top:10px; } */
        .headerValue { float:left; background-color: #556292; color: White; text-align: center; border-top: solid 1px #004528; border-right: solid 1px #ece9d8; border-bottom: solid 1px #004528; border-left: solid 1px #004528; padding: 3px; margin:0 0 1px 0; width:149px; }
        .headerDescription { float:left; background-color: #556292; color: White; text-align: center; border-top: solid 1px #004528; border-right: solid 1px #ece9d8; border-bottom: solid 1px #004528; border-left: solid 1px #004528; padding: 3px; margin:0 0 1px 0; width:263px; }

        .noDataLabel {Width:680px; line-height:60px;  font-weight:bold; }
        
        .dataTable { width:650px; border-collapse: collapse; border-bottom: solid 1px #ece9d8; }
        .dataTable th { background-color: #004528; color: White; text-align: center; border-top: solid 1px #004528; border-right: solid 1px #ece9d8; border-bottom: solid 1px #004528; border-left: solid 1px #004528; padding: 3px; }
        .dataTable th.last { border-right: solid 1px #004528; }
        .dataTable .alternateRow { background-color: #ece9d8; }
        .dataTable td { border-right: solid 1px #ece9d8; border-left: solid 1px #ece9d8; padding: 2px; }

        .colTradDate{ Width:214px; }
        .colAmount{ Width:149px; }
        .colNote { Width:263px; }
        
		.chartHeader {Width:680px; background-color: #556292; color:#FFF; padding:5px 0;}
		.headerLabel{  font-weight:bold; margin-left:10px;}
		.tradedateLabel{  margin-left:230px; }
		.amountLabel{  margin-left:20px; }
		
		.buttonExcel { margin-left:280px;}
		.hsfundBorder { width:733px; border-left:solid 1px #666; border-right:solid 1px #666; float:left; }
		.hsUserControlBorder { position:relative; width:733px; border-left:solid 1px #666; border-right:solid 1px #666;  border-bottom:solid 1px #666; float:left; overflow:auto;}
		.upHistoricalNAVs {margin-left:20px; margin-right:20px;}
		.fundsHistText { font-size:18px; margin:0 0 20px 0}
		.panelGridview { margin-top:0px; margin-bottom:10px; width:680px; overflow:auto; clear:both;}
		.panelDisclaimers {margin-left:10px; margin-right:20px; }
		.pnlHeader { margin-left:5px; margin-bottom:3px;}
		
		.cannedDay { font-size:smaller;}
		.chkcannedDay{font-size:smaller; padding-left:395px;}
		
		.chartLoadingImage { position:absolute;	top:350px; left:50%;z-index:1001; }   

		.tableLoadingImage { position:absolute;	top:720px; left:40%;z-index:1001; }   

